Key Specifications

This TDK MLCC boasts several critical specifications that define its performance and suitability for various designs. The ‘Apps.’ attribute indicates it is a ‘Commercial Grade’ component, meaning it is designed for general-purpose electronic devices and systems where standard reliability and performance are required, as opposed to specialized automotive or medical grades. The ‘Brand’ is ‘TDK’, assuring users of the component’s origin from a reputable manufacturer known for quality and innovation in passive components. The ‘Feature’ is ‘General’, further emphasizing its broad applicability. A ‘Tolerance’ of ‘±10%’ signifies that the actual capacitance value will be within 10% of the nominal 22nF, which is a standard tolerance for many commercial applications, balancing cost and precision. The ‘L x W Size’ is ‘0.6mm x 0.3mm [EIA 0201]’, highlighting its extremely small footprint, making it ideal for high-density PCB designs where space is at a premium. This ‘0201’ EIA code is one of the smallest standard package sizes available. The ‘Capacitance’ of ’22nF’ (nanofarads) is the component’s primary electrical characteristic, indicating its ability to store charge. ‘T(Max.) / mm’ at ‘0.35’ refers to the maximum thickness of the component, critical for designs with strict height constraints. The ‘Temp. Chara.’ of ‘X7R’ is a dielectric material classification, indicating that the capacitor’s capacitance will change by no more than ‘±15%’ over the ‘Operating Temp. Range / °C’ of ‘-55 to 125’. This ‘Cap.Change or Temp.Coef.’ value of ‘±15%’ is typical for X7R dielectrics, making them suitable for decoupling, bypassing, and filtering applications where temperature stability is important but not ultra-critical. The ‘Component Type’ is clearly defined as a ‘Ceramic Capacitor (MLCC)’, specifying its construction and material. Its ‘Product Status’ is ‘Production’, confirming that it is actively manufactured and readily available. Finally, the ‘Rated Voltage [DC] / V’ of ’50’ indicates the maximum DC voltage that can be continuously applied across the capacitor without risk of breakdown, providing ample headroom for many common low-voltage digital and analog circuits.

Typical Applications

This TDK ceramic capacitor finds extensive use across numerous electronic applications due to its small size, stable performance, and robust construction:
  • Decoupling and Bypass Filtering: In digital circuits, it is commonly used to decouple power supply lines, providing a stable voltage source to integrated circuits (ICs) by shunting high-frequency noise to ground. This prevents voltage fluctuations from affecting sensitive digital operations, ensuring data integrity and system stability.
  • Signal Filtering: The C0603X7R1H223K030BB can be integrated into low-pass, high-pass, or band-pass filters to remove unwanted frequencies from signals, crucial in audio circuits, RF modules, and sensor interfaces to improve signal clarity and reduce interference.
  • Timing Circuits: While not a primary timing component, it can be used in conjunction with resistors in RC timing circuits for applications such as oscillators, delays, and pulse generation, particularly in microcontrollers and embedded systems.
  • Impedance Matching: In RF applications, these capacitors can be used for impedance matching networks, ensuring maximum power transfer between different stages of a circuit, such as between an antenna and a transceiver.
  • General Purpose Energy Storage: In power management circuits, it can serve as a small energy reservoir to smooth out ripples in rectified DC voltage or provide instantaneous current bursts to loads, contributing to overall power supply stability.
